sustanciero
  27

Office, now disappeared, of the years of hunger and misery of our post-war period which they also called savor. "The suso has arrived." Thus was announced this character that he had tied with a rope a ham or cow bone that he introduced by a fat bitch for a few minutes in the pout of the poor or by a peseta for a quarter of an hour. It remained until the 1960s.
